What's the best hashrate you can pull with monero cryptonight? Mine does 840 h/s @ 126W 56C +110 clock -500 mem clock with 60x34 launch-config ccminer. People report up to 900 but can't seem to go near the drivers crash if I overclock more.
It's not worth doing monero on 1080ti. A 580 does 700h/s at 90w. Vega 64 does 1000h/s at 110w. Best to stick with zec/skunk/skein.
